Description: Bluebottle Grove, Colchester. This bank is an Iron Age earthwork that was part of the western defences of pre-roman Camvlodvnvm the capital for the Trinovantes tribe. The largest section of the Lexden earthworks still in existence is the Grymes Dyke see 142663
